You can mod your own game. Find the below .xml file. Make a copy of it in your mygames/fallenenchantress/mods folder with the below edits (or whatever you want as an edit). I've changed the below to be that I don't see a tile unless it has 3 material. You could change that to be 7 as a minimum total and you'd only see ones with either 2/5, 3/4, 4/3's. I don't know exactly what the first 2 lines are...but I never see a 4/4.
